The Frankfurt School's legacy in academia includes the development of critical theory, which critiques capitalism and explores the relationship between culture and power structures. Its ideas have influenced discussions on cultural Marxism, emphasizing how cultural institutions shape societal beliefs and behaviors, thus serving as a foundation for contemporary social justice movements. journalism.university University of Tennessee at Martin
